Miquel Ninyerola is a scholar working on Global and Planetary Change, Atmospheric Science and Nature and Landscape Conservation. According to data from OpenAlex, Miquel Ninyerola has authored 44 papers receiving a total of 3.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Global and Planetary Change, 15 papers in Atmospheric Science and 14 papers in Nature and Landscape Conservation. Recurrent topics in Miquel Ninyerola’s work include Species Distribution and Climate Change (11 papers),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(11 papers) and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(9 papers). Miquel Ninyerola is often cited by papers focused on Species Distribution and Climate Change (11 papers),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(11 papers) and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(9 papers). Miquel Ninyerola collaborates with scholars based in Spain, United States and The Netherlands. Miquel Ninyerola's co-authors include Xavier Pons, Joan Maria Roure, Jordi Cristóbal, Josep Peñuelas, Jofre Carnicer, Marta Coll, Gerardo Sánchez, José A. Sobrino, Juan C. Jiménez‐Muñoz and G. Sòria and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res and Global Change Biology.
